oooh, i'm slightly sore. it's 9am and I've already done 3 hours of violin practice. I'm working tonight and have a full day at uni, so this was the only time i could get my practice done. Did work on scales, Kreutzer, my orchestra pieces, and then work on my pieces - Telemann and Haydn, then Weiniawski and Suk. Suk's come on really well, and really quickly. I really like the piece, and it's AMus level, but not too hard (or so I've found). And a fairly exciting piece to play.

Hmm, Got to get this concert organised. I'm organising a concert in December with some of my friends to show what talent there is in our younger generation of musicians. I know it's only End of September/Early October, but I've still got to get some posters up and advertising started - Especially around uni's seeing as the uni students will be off from uni in November.
